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. That’s why it’s essential to recognize the warning signs of a leak and take action quickly. Here are some common warning signs that you need leak detection services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that linger in your home or business can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can be a sign of mold growth and other serious issues.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Unusual Noises or Sounds

Unusual noises or sounds, such as dripping or running water, can be a sign of a leak. Don’t ignore these sounds, as they can be a sign of a more significant issue.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these bills, as they can be a sign of a more significant issue.

Leak Detection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No Easy to fix with a wrench and some Teflon tape.
Large water stain on ceiling No Yes May show a more significant issue, such as a leaky roof or pipe.
Unusual noises or sounds No Yes May show a hidden leak or other serious issue.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es May show water damage from a leak.
Increased water bills No Yes May show a hidden leak or other serious issue.
Musty odors that won’t go away No Yes May show mold growth or other serious issue.
